The Curious Incident of The Dog in The Night Time
23rd April 2025

Students from UC4 to SFC1 gave a powerful and memorable performance in an adaptation of The Curious Incident of The Dog in The Night-Time, Mark Haddon’s bestselling book.

The whole cast were onstage throughout the performance, and they were integral in creating main character Chris’ world. Using only movement, blocks, umbrellas and projection they created a wide range of locations including train stations, the London Underground and a beach, through original and innovative staging.

The performances given by the students were sensitive and moving, and allowed the audience to empathise with the challenges faced by a neurodivergent teenager.

A special mention goes to UC4 Annabelle who played Chris who, along with UC4 Natasha (Chris’ mother), UC4 Josephine (Chris’ father) and UC5 Rosie (Chris’ teacher), was able to draw the audience into Chris’ experience of the world.

Mrs Revell, Head of Drama
